Young‐Woo Park is a scholar working on Electrical and Electronic Engineering, Mechanical Engineering and Molecular Biology. According to data from OpenAlex, Young‐Woo Park has authored 85 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Electrical and Electronic Engineering, 13 papers in Mechanical Engineering and 11 papers in Molecular Biology. Recurrent topics in Young‐Woo Park’s work include Innovative Human-Technology Interaction (9 papers), Magnetic Properties and Applications (9 papers) and Electric Motor Design and Analysis (7 papers). Young‐Woo Park is often cited by papers focused on Innovative Human-Technology Interaction (9 papers), Magnetic Properties and Applications (9 papers) and Electric Motor Design and Analysis (7 papers). Young‐Woo Park collaborates with scholars based in South Korea, United States and Germany.
